NIH Grant Funding

With a grant from the National Institute of Neurological Diseases and Stroke, part of the National Institutes of Health, U-M becomes home to one of only five Morris K. Udall Centers of Excellence in Parkinson’s Disease Research in the country. Named for a noted member of Congress who battled the disease, the Udall Centers bring together researchers from many fields to tackle big questions in Parkinson’s, to educate the next generation of Parkinson’s researchers, and to serve as a vital resource for patients with the disease.
